Key Daily Habits for Growth Line Cultivation

1. Morning Routine

Starting the day with a structured morning routine sets a positive tone. This can include activities such as meditation, exercise, and planning for the day ahead.

  • Wake up early to have uninterrupted time.
  • Incorporate physical activity to boost energy levels.
  • Spend time in reflection or meditation to enhance focus.

2. Continuous Learning

Engaging in continuous learning is vital for personal growth. This can be achieved through reading, online courses, or attending workshops.

  • Set a goal to read a certain number of books each month.
  • Enroll in online courses related to your field.
  • Join discussion groups or forums to exchange ideas.

3. Networking and Relationships

Building and maintaining relationships is crucial for growth. Networking opens doors to new opportunities and insights.

  • Attend industry events to meet like-minded individuals.
  • Schedule regular check-ins with mentors or peers.
  • Utilize social media to connect with professionals.

4. Goal Setting

Setting clear, achievable goals is a fundamental habit for growth. This helps in tracking progress and maintaining motivation.

  • Use the SMART criteria to define your goals.
  • Break larger goals into smaller, manageable tasks.
  • Review and adjust goals regularly to remain aligned with your objectives.

5. Reflection and Journaling

Taking time to reflect on experiences and journaling can provide clarity and insight. This practice helps in recognizing growth and areas for improvement.

  • Set aside time each day to write about your experiences.
  • Reflect on what you learned and how you can apply it.
  • Use journaling prompts to guide your reflections.
